Icebreaker Toolkit: Simple Openers That Actually Start Conversations

Feeling unsure what to say is normal. Use these low-pressure, adaptable openers to turn a profile glance into a real conversation without sounding boring, clingy, or robotic.

Pattern-based openers you can tweak

  • Observation + question: Notice one specific detail from their profile and ask a related, easy question. Example: "I saw you hike in your photos—what trail surprised you the most?"
  • Odd-one-out game: Offer three quick options tied to something in their profile and ask them to pick. Example: "Coffee, beach sunset, or big-city rooftop—which one wins for a Saturday?"
  • Micro compliment + follow-up: Keep praise specific and pair it with a neutral question. Example: "Nice playlist in your profile—what’s a song I should definitely hear?"
  • Shared-interest pivot: Briefly mention the shared interest and suggest a small exchange. Example: "You love indie films too—got a favorite I should add to my watchlist?"

Low-pressure questions that invite a reply

  • "What’s one small hobby you couldn’t give up?"
  • "If today was an ideal day off, what would you do first?"
  • "Which snack always makes a bad day better?"

How to avoid common pitfalls

  • Skip generic openers: Messages like "Hey" or "Sup" rarely lead anywhere—add one detail so your message feels personal.
  • Don’t over-flatter: Avoid long compliments about looks. Short, specific praise tied to an interest feels more genuine.
  • Steer clear of heavy topics: First messages should not ask deeply personal or emotionally intense questions.
  • Avoid copy-paste lines: Slightly adapt each opener to something from the person’s profile so it reads as thoughtful, not scripted.

Small techniques that improve replies

  • Offer a choice: Questions with two clear options are easy to answer and keep momentum: "City walk or coffee shop?"
  • Use light callbacks: If they mentioned something earlier, reference it briefly to show you listened: "You said you love pasta—what’s your go-to order?"
  • Keep the first message short: One or two sentences lower pressure and make replying simple.

Use these patterns as a starting point. Swap details from a match’s profile, keep the tone relaxed, and aim to spark curiosity—not an interview. Small, specific, and friendly beats clever and vague every time on Mingle2.
